Title: Jay N Gaba - Innovator in Content Management Systems
Introduction
Jay N Gaba is a notable inventor based in Bengaluru, India. He has made significant contributions to the field of content management systems, particularly in optimizing content sharing within enterprise storage systems. His innovative approach has paved the way for more efficient peer-to-peer content sharing.
Latest Patents
Jay N Gaba holds a patent titled "Server-orchestrated peer-to-peer content sharing in CMS and sync-n-share applications." This patent focuses on optimizing content sharing in an enterprise storage system using a content management system that features an orchestration server. The orchestration server coordinates access and sharing of content over a local area network (LAN) directly between peer-to-peer end-user enterprise clients. Clients are organized into content sharing groups authorized to share specific content. Upon receiving a request for content, the orchestration server identifies other clients in the same group with valid copies of the requested content. It establishes secure peer-to-peer communications and coordinates the transfer of content over the LAN to the requesting client. For multiple clients with valid content, the orchestration server efficiently manages the transfer using multiple threads.
